Easy Upgrades for Improved Airflow



To ensure a cool PC, small adjustments can have a big effect. Let's explore some easy modifications to boost airflow and enhance system performance.

First of all, think about adding or improving your case fans. Many PC cases come with minimal fans, which may be inadequate for effective cooling. By adding more fans, especially ones with good reviews for airflow, you're setting your system up for better cooling. Positioning a fan to pull air in and another to blow it out can create an efficient airflow.

Next, look at your cable management. It might seem irrelevant, but tangled cables can restrict airflow and increase your PC's temperature. Organize the cables using zip ties or Velcro straps to bundle them together. If you can route those cables behind the motherboard tray, that’s even more beneficial! With less disorder, cool air can flow more efficiently through your case.


Last but not least, don’t forget dust buildup. It can build up and block your fans and vents over time. Consistently cleaning dust from your case and components is important for airflow. A can of compressed air can assist with difficult spots and ensure smooth performance.

Choosing the Right Cooling Solution

First, contemplate the cooling solution that suits your requirements. Here are the main approaches:

Fan-Based Cooling: This is the most popular and generally the cheapest option. It uses cooling fans and heat sinks to reduce heat. If you are looking for a simple and effective approach, this might be it.

Fluid-Driven Cooling: For those who aim for heightened performance, liquid cooling can be a great solution. It’s often quieter and can handle bigger heat loads, making it great for overclocking.

Passive Heat Management: This method depends on heat sinks only, with no fans needed. It’s quiet and power-saving but not suitable for high-performance setups.



Subsequently, consider your PC case and components. Check that the cooling solution you select fits appropriately within your setup. You don’t want to buy something only to find out it won’t fit!

Finally, consider installation and maintenance. Some solutions like AIO liquid cooling systems are straightforward to install, whereas custom loops can be complicated. If you’re not familiar with complicated configurations, air coolers are often easier to manage. Also, make sure to clean regularly! Dust buildup can hinder performance, so choose an easily cleanable solution.
